Which describes the importance of the Battles of Gettysburg and Vicksburg?
a. They convinced England to enter the war on the side of the Confederacy.
b. They proved that the rifled musket and other new weapons were ineffective.
c. They were decisive victories that allowed Confederate armies to invade the North.
d. They turned the war in the Union's favor in both the East and the West.

The best option regarding the importance of the Battles of Gettysburg and Vicksburg would be that "
d. They turned the war in the Union's favor in both the East and the West," since these were victories for the North.
